Low number of deaths in Taiwan from Covid-19 is not proof that masks work. Why didn’t masks stop a severe flu epidemic there in 2019? Have a look at this article.
https://www.taiwannews.com.tw/en/news/3641454
In the space of just over one week alone “Over 99,000 emergency room visits were made due to flu-like symptoms”
Similarly Japan, which, like Taiwan, also has a long history of mask-wearing, had it’s worst ever flu epidemic in 2019. Millions were struck down suffering from symptoms. Many died. Japan has had relatively few Covid-19 deaths too.
According to some expert opinion, a more credible explanation is that the most significant factor is the existence of high levels of cross-immunity across the region acquired from prior exposure to respiratory viruses similar to SARS-Cov-2.
This piece from The Business Insider says exactly that.
“Many people who’ve never gotten COVID-19 seem to have memory T cells that can recognize the new coronavirus.
The likeliest explanation for these findings is a phenomenon called cross-reactivity: when T cells developed in response to another virus react to a similar but previously unknown pathogen. In this case, experts think these cross-reactive T cells likely come from previous exposure to other coronaviruses — those that cause common colds.”
